The Role The Patient Engagement and Enrollment Specialist plays a crucial role in the clinical trial process. You would truly be the face of the company and the first point of contact for many patients. Some of the people you speak with have never participated in a clinical trial and may be nervous or have many questions; your job is to guide them through the process and make them feel comfortable.

On a day-to-day basis, you’ll be contacting, screening, and scheduling potential patients into clinical research studies. You'll be working out of a busy, high-performing clinic, and also goign out into the community to participate in events and engagement initiatives! When speaking with patients you’ll be confirming interest in the trial, asking qualifying questions, and scheduling them to start in the trial.
